How they compare

Paraguay currently reports 25 m3 against 23 m3 in Sudan, a difference of 2 m3.

That makes Paraguay's figure about 1.1 times Sudan's.

The two have swapped places 3 times across 8 shared years of data; in 2017 it was Sudan ahead.

Paraguay ranks 174th and Sudan ranks 177th of 228 countries.

Across the 2 decades both report, Paraguay averaged higher in 1 and Sudan in 1.

The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products. More detailed information on wood products, including definitions, can be found at: https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en
